Obituary for Claude Washington Gossett Jr.

Claude Washington Gossett, Jr.,81, of Athens, died Thursday afternoon, February 4, 2016 at UT Medical Center in Knoxville.
He was a native of Pawhuska, Oklahoma and was a son of the late Claude W, Sr. and Cora Collins Gossett. He was also preceded in death by two sisters, Sue Wilson and Mary Germany.
He attended Allen Memorial United Methodist Church. He was a graduate of Lamar University in Beaumont, Texas, he received his master's degree from the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ary and received his Phd in Music Education from the University of Southern Mississippi. He served as Professor of Voice at Auburn University for 26 years, retiring as Professor Emeritus. He served on the Athletic Committee, served as President of the Faculty Senate and was Faculty Advisor to the Auburn University Gospel Choir. He served as Minister of Music at Highland Avenue Baptist Church in Beaumont, Texas, Friendship Baptist Church in Groves, Texas, First Baptist Church in Murfreesboro, TN, Broadway Baptist Church in Hattiesburg, MS, Auburn United Methodist Church in Auburn, Alabama. He was active in the National Association of Teachers of Singing, serving in various offices at the regional and national levels. He was a member of the Lions Club, Omicron Delta Kappa Leadership Honorary, Phi Mu Alpha Sinfonia, and Twin City Lodge No. 76 F and AM. He served in the U.S. Army.
He is survived by his wife Sylvia Corley Gossett of Athens; one daughter and son-in-law, Kay and Mike Simmons of Athens; one son and daughter-in-law, Claude W, III and DeLeith Gossett of Lubbock, Texas; two granddaughters, Bethany Hedger and Tori Gaddis; five grandsons, Josh Simmons, Jake Simmons, Drew Simmons, Chris Gossett and Grant Gossett; and 10 great-grandchildren.
A memorial service will be conducted at 7:00 pm, Tuesday, February 9, 2016 at Allen Memorial United Methodist Church with Rev. Charla Sherbacoff and Rev. Jake Simmons officiating. The family will receive friends from 5:00-6:30 pm Tuesday at the church prior to the memorial service. A private family graveside service will be conducted at Cedar Grove Cemetery.
Pallbearers will be Josh and Drew Simmons, Peter Hedger, Jr, Chris and Grant Gossett, and Brent Gaddis.
The family suggests memorials be made to the 4 Little Girls Scholarship Fund at Auburn University.
